Michael Bierut studied graphic design at the University of Cincinnati's College of Design, Architecture, Art and Planning, graduating summa cum laude in 1980.He worked for ten years at Vignelli Associates before joining Pentagram as a partner in 1990.. His clients at Pentagram have included The New York Times, Saks Fifth Avenue, The Robin Hood Foundation, MIT Media Lab, Mastercard, Bobby . Born in Cleveland, Ohio, in 1957, Bierut's love of fine art, music, drawing and reading led him—as a teen—to two books on graphic design: the Graphic Design Manual by Armin Hofmann and Milton Glaser: Graphic Design. Bierut served as the national president of AIGA from 1998 to 2001 and currently serves as a senior critic in graphic design at the Yale School of Art.
